Alone in a big old house, a woman sorts through relics from her family’s past and finds that she’s trying harder and harder to convince herself that ghosts don’t exist. The only thing keeping her sane is her diary… And she is keeping sane isn’t she?

Heirloom was written by Arthur Mcbain and Owen Jenkins and was originally created for ‘At Your Peril’, a podcast anthology series of deliciously dark and frighteningly funny original stories. For more episodes search ‘At Your Peril’ wherever you get your podcasts.

Grace Dunne (Performer):

Grace is an actress and voiceover artist living in London. She attended Drama Studio London and has been working in the industry nearly 10 years. Her recent credits include performing in The Crystal Maze in London’s West End and Cushty The West End immersive dining experience, a comedy pilot for the BBC last year called ‘Surprise of your Life’ and narrated the BBC documentary ‘My Faith and Me’ and just voiced one of the lead roles in the new Warhammer video game.
